GoForum🌐 V2EX

我发现 macOS 下 GPT Codex 不太擅长调用命令行工具

ShadowPower · 2026-06-04 13:58 · 0 次点赞 · 2 条回复

如果只是使用 Read/Write 工具,编译、运行、测试代码项目,基本都差不多

但是,我平时有个需求,把项目代码打包到 tar.zst 包,顺便排除.venv 、node_modules 之类的目录

刚用 macOS 跑了一次这个操作,用 Codex+GPT 5.5 high 。结果做起来磕磕绊绊的,花费了超过平时做这件事需要的 4 倍 token (与 Windows 、Linux 对比)

https://i.imgur.com/GikLiht.png

https://i.imgur.com/dqv1oXC.png

还有,用 sed -i 的时候经常只给一个参数,然后报错,再给两个参数……

看来只是 macOS 版本的软件出得早,模型本身还是针对 Linux 命令训练的

2 条回复
lel020 · 2026-06-04 14:08
#1

感觉还是 agent 层面提示没够, 模型就算是几年前的 gpt3 也能很好的区分 mac 常见命令和 linux 的区别, 到 5.5 不太可能是训练数据问题,更可能还是权重没有重视你当前的系统是 macos ,AGENTS.md 补充强调一下必须按 mac 版使用命令应该能好些,

Alias4ck · 2026-06-04 14:13
#2

在全局 AGENTS.md 声明就好了 比如之前一直会用 python 告诉它我只有 python3 ,它再也不会用了

添加回复
你还需要 登录 后发表回复

登录后可发帖和回复

登录 注册
主题信息
作者: ShadowPower
发布: 2026-06-04
点赞: 0
回复: 0